Slinger Rings for Oil Pumps

Slinger rings are commonly used in oil pumps to help maintain proper lubrication and prevent contaminants from entering the pump assembly. These rings are typically located near the shaft seal or bearing housing to ensure that oil is distributed evenly and efficiently throughout the pump.

Wearing Rings in Centrifugal Pump

Wearing rings, also known as wear rings, are essential components in centrifugal pumps that help to minimize internal leakage and improve pump efficiency. These rings are typically installed on the impeller skirt, in the pump casing, or in both locations to create a tight clearance between the impeller and the casing.

Centrifugal Pump Double Wear Rings

In some high-performance centrifugal pumps, double wear rings are used to further enhance pump efficiency and reliability. Double wear rings consist of two sets of rings installed on both the impeller skirt and the pump casing, providing additional protection against wear and improving overall pump performance.
